What are bars in the context of employment?

In the context of employment, 'bars' typically refer to establishments where alcoholic beverages are served to customers for on-site consumption. Jobs at bars can include bartenders, barbacks, servers, and managers who are responsible for preparing and serving drinks, maintaining the bar area, ensuring customer satisfaction, and adhering to legal regulations regarding alcohol service. Working at a bar often requires good communication skills, the ability to work in a fast-paced environment, and knowledge of drink recipes and responsible alcohol service.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a bartender,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Bartender, you need a solid understanding of drink recipes, beverage service, and safe alcohol handling, often supported by a responsible beverage service certification.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ems and inventory management tools is typically required. Exceptional interpersonal skills, multitasking ability, and a friendly demeanor help bartenders build rapport with patrons and manage busy environments. These skills are crucial for ensuring customer satisfaction, efficient operations, and compliance with safety regulations in hospitality settings.

What are some common challenges bartenders face during busy shifts, and how can they manage them effectively?

Bartenders often encounter challenges such as managing multiple orders at once, maintaining a clean and organized workspace, and ensuring high-quality customer service during peak hours. Effective time management, strong multitasking skills, and clear communication with both customers and fellow staff are crucial for success. Building familiarity with the menu and practicing efficient drink-making techniques can also help bartenders stay composed and deliver a positive experience even when the bar is crowded.

Is bar work a good career?

Bar work is a common entry-level job in the hospitality industry that involves serving drinks, customer service, and maintaining the bar area. It can offer flexible hours, tips, and social interaction, but may also involve late nights and physically demanding work. Career advancement opportunities include supervisory roles or moving into management with experience and additional skills.

What positions are in a bar?

Common positions in a bar include bartenders, barbacks, servers, and managers. Bartenders prepare and serve drinks, while barbacks assist with stock and cleanliness. Skills such as customer service and knowledge of alcohol are often required, and shifts can include evenings and weekends.

Position Summary: 

Responsible for the assembly and wiring of electrical components in an electrical control panel for the successful operation of air pollution control and water treatment equipment. 

Duties include but not limited to: Install electrical wiring and assemble components according to blueprints and electrical diagrams. 

Assemble electrical panels according to wiring specifications. 

Drill and tap holes in specified locations for mounting control units, push buttons and other devices using hand tools, drills and other applicable tools.

Attach breakers, relays, contactors, bus bars, transformers, push buttons, HMI screens, meters, plugging devices and fuse blocks to mounting holes with bolts and screws using wrenches, screwdrivers, and nut drivers.

Cut, bend and form conduit pipe and tubing used to connect circuits and sub-assemblies.

Connect color coded wires, and crimp to wire ends.
